I don't mind about adding this new functionality, but I'm a bit concerned about increase if the size of SPL binary (as it sets the DM_FLAG_PRE_RELOC).
Do you have any data about increase of the final binary size?
Yes, following what you've pointed me below(using board kp_imx6q_tpc with buildman) these are the results(from patch 1 to 7): 01: clk: imx: pllv3: register PLLV3 GENERIC and USB as 2 different clocks 07: clk: imx: pllv3: add support for PLLV3_AV type arm: (for 1/1 boards) all +963.0 data +136.0 rodata +99.0 spl/u-boot-spl:all +831.0 spl/u-boot-spl:data +136.0 spl/u-boot-spl:rodata +99.0 spl/u-boot-spl:text +596.0 text +728.0
So for SPL, as I understand, latest text increment of +728 should be taken because it's the sum of text(596)+data(136) then padded, right? So SPL increased not few.
The buildman script has options to check the difference of the final binary (i.e. SPL) size (as provided by Tom Rini):
./tools/buildman/$ export SOURCE_DATE_EPOCH=`date +%s` $ ./tools/buildman/buildman -o /tmp/test --step 0 -b origin/master.. --force-build -CveE $ ./tools/buildman/buildman -o /tmp/test --step 0 -b origin/master.. -Ssdel
to get size changes between point A and point Z in a branch, and omit --step 0 when I need to see which patch in between them caused the size change.
If the SPL growth is too big - maybe we shall introduce some Kconfig options to add a separate support for those PLLv3 options ?
If you want I can slice drivers down with different Kconfig entries and corresponding clk-pllv3-generic.c, clk-pllv3-usb.c etc. Or maybe using #ifdef inside the same file?
Anyway the only board using this except imxrt1050-evk is kp_imx6q_tpc, so this should be easy to test.
